From ae7c96889f3fb6aec5909bec7c7d77377ab59cc9 Mon Sep 17 00:00:00 2001 From: Nico Huber Date: Thu, 23 May 2013 18:13:23 +0200 Subject: Start ACPI framework for PnP (super i/o) devices I'm trying to make writing ACPI code for super i/o devices more comfortable. pnp.asl hosts some general cpp macros. The other four files are to be included in dsdt trees. They are controlled by cpp macros which should be defined/undefined before inclusion. Work was inspired by Christoph Grenz' ACPI code for the W83627HF.
